About the Game

Kingdom is an abstract strategy game played on a 9x9 board with a King piece and stacks of 1-4 checkers called Knights. Pieces can move to an adjacent empty cell or jump over an adjacent piece. Knights may only jump over a Knight smaller than themselves, except a one-high Knight may jump over a four-high Knight. Pieces capture by moving into an enemy piece's space. Any piece may capture a King, and Kings may capture Knights, but Knights may not capture Knights (they only block each other). The player who captures the enemy king or occupies the enemy king's starting location wins.
